16
Q

what are the characteristics of reptiles

A

dry scales, egg laying, ectotherms, 4 or 0 legs, breathe air, ear holes instead of ears

17
Q

what are the characteristics of amphibians

A

moist skin, ectotherms, egg laying, 4 legs, webbed feet

18
Q

what are the characteristics of birds

A

feathers and wings, egg laying, beaks, 2 legs, endotherms, ear holes instead of ears

19
Q

what are the characteristics of mammals

A

hair or fur, birth live young, produce milk, endotherms, have external ears, breathe air
